
Here we will show you step-by-step how to simplify the square root of 1308. The square root of 1308 can be written as follows:
√ | 1308 |
The √ symbol is called the radical sign. To simplify the square root of 1308 means to get the simplest radical form of √1308.
Step 1: List Factors
List the factors of 1308 like so:
1, 2, 3, 4, 6, 12, 109, 218, 327, 436, 654, 1308
Step 2: Find Perfect Squares
Identify the perfect squares* from the list of factors above:
1, 4
Step 3: Divide
Divide 1308 by the largest perfect square you found in the previous step:
1308 / 4 = 327
Step 4: Calculate
Calculate the square root of the largest perfect square:
√4 = 2
Step 5: Get Answer
Put Steps 3 and 4 together to get the square root of 1308 in its simplest form:
2 | √ | 327 |
